Workflow
Drop a vector PDF drawing set. A 52-page CD set loads in about 11 seconds.
Set scale → click along each wall → press Enter to close → pick the wall type.
Every line cites its AS 3700 / NCC clause, ready for a QS to review.
Coverage
Brick veneer / cavity / single skin, wall ties, weep holes, lintels, mortar mix.
Shower, WC, kitchen — AS 3740 skirting upturn auto-added at 0.15 m.
Tile / timber / vinyl / carpet — 8 pattern types incl. herringbone, hex, brick bond.
Door + window schedule auto-built from your hand-typed list or paste.
Slabs, stairs, columns, hubs — area × thickness, AS 3600 rebate / cutout support.
Split by trade, every line cites its clause. Not for ordering — needs QS review.
Who made it
I'm a builder in Australia. TuLiang started because takeoff on real residential jobs was either a $5k/year QS suite I did not need, or a spreadsheet that lost an hour per drawing set. So I built the tool I wanted on site: open a PDF, mark what is actually there, get numbers that cite their AS 3700 / NCC clause — then hand it to the QS to check. — Made by an Australian builder · 1.5 years on the tools
